Designed for Hazardous Environments

Safety in industrial settings is non-negotiable, especially in environments where flammable gases or dust may be present. The DPI620G platform addresses this critical concern directly, being designed for hazardous environments. With ATEX, IECEx, and ETL approved intrinsically safe versions available, it ensures safe operation in potentially explosive atmospheres. This makes the DPI620G the preferred choice for countless operators across the globe in sectors like oil and gas, chemical processing, and mining, where stringent safety standards are a must. These certifications signify that the device has been rigorously tested and confirmed to not generate enough energy to ignite a hazardous atmosphere. The availability of 14 safe area and 5 hazardous area models allows companies to satisfy both budget and specific application requirements, from a basic electrical calibrator to a full-fledged multifunction calibrator with advanced communication capabilities like HART, Profibus, and Fieldbus.

Modular System, Diverse Configurations

The Genii Advanced Modular Calibration System, with the DPI620G at its core, offers unparalleled flexibility through its modular system, diverse configurations. The DPI620G can be used with various accessories to form dedicated calibration solutions. For instance, it can be combined with pressure modules and a module carrier or a pressure base station. A significant new release is the DPI620G-B modular electrical calibrator, offering a cost-effective electrical measurement solution. When paired with Druck’s pressure generation stations (like the PV624) and pressure modules (PM620), it creates a dedicated portable hybrid pressure calibrator. This modularity extends to specific pressure ranges: a DPI620G-B + PV622 + PM620 forms a portable pressure calibrator capable of generating pressures up to 100 bar pneumatic, while a DPI620G-B + PV623 + PM620 handles pressures up to an astonishing 1,000 bar. For workshop environments, a fully automated workshop calibration system can be assembled using the DPI620G-B, a Rack Mount Kit, a PACE Controller, and 4Sight2 software.

Specialized Communication and Data Management

The DPI620G also excels in specialized communication and data management, crucial for modern industrial environments. A new release, the DPI620G-H modular HART communicator, specifically offers a cost-effective HART Communicator solution with free-of-charge access to the latest DD library. This ensures that users always have the most up-to-date information for configuring and troubleshooting HART-enabled devices. Beyond communication, the DPI620G features an autonomous calibration wizard to store procedures and calibration data. This powerful function streamlines recurring tasks, ensuring consistency and reducing manual data entry errors. It can also data log up to six channels simultaneously, providing comprehensive records of multiple parameters during a test. Furthermore, the DPI620G is provided with one Freemium 4Sight2 calibration software license, enabling robust data analysis, reporting, and asset management, completing a powerful calibration ecosystem.

Specifications

PV621G, PV622G and PV623G specification
Maximum pressure PV621G 20 bar (300 psi) pneumatic
PV622G 100 bar (1,500 psi) pneumatic
PV623G 1,000 bar (15,000 psi) hydraulic
Pressure media PV621G and PV622G non-corrosive gases,
PV623G de-mineralized water or mineral oil
(ISO viscosity grade < 22)
Operating temperature -10° to 50°C (14° to 122°F)
For water +4 to +50°C (39 to 122°F)
Storage temperature -20 to 70°C (-4 to 158°F) (must be empty of water)
Shock and vibration BS EN 61010-1; MIL-PRF-28800F for Class II equipment,
1 m drop tested
Pressure safety Pressure equipment directive class SEP
Approval CE and UKCA Marked
Size and weight 450 mm x 280 mm x 235 mm,
PV621G 2.65 kg, PV622G 3.30 kg,
PV623G 3.75 kg
PV621-IS, PV622-IS and PV623-IS specification
(where different from above table)
Maximum pressure PV621-IS 20 bar (300 psi) pneumatic
PV622-IS 100 bar (1,500 psi) pneumatic
PV623-IS 1,000 bar (15,000 psi) hydraulic
Operating temperature -10 to 40°C (14 to 104°F)
Approval CE and UKCA Marked
ATEX and IECEx intrinsically safe: II 2G Ex ia IIC T4
Gb (-10°C ≤ Ta ≤ +40°C)
ETL intrinsically safe (US and Canada): Class I, Zone 1,
AEx/Ex ia IIC T4 (-10°C ≤ Ta ≤ +40°C)
